Redmi A3 Plus is an upcoming smartphone. The phone is expected to launch with a 6.5 inches IPS LCD screen, and 720 x 1600 pixels resolution. It runs on Android 14-based OS with MediaTek Helio G96 chipset. It will have a 5000mAh battery with 10W charging.
The device will feature a side-mounted fingerprint and an accelerometer sensor. It will offer 64GB internal storage options with 6GB RAM. There will be a 13MP Dual camera on the back and a single 8MP selfie shooter. The device supports GSM, HSPA, and LTE networks.
